Medieval architecture developed in Europe from the 5th to the 15th centuries during the Middle Ages. The style of architecture was influenced by cultural and religious beliefs of the time and practical considerations such as the need for protection and the desire to display wealth and power.. WebArt. The High Middle Ages were a time of tremendous growth in Europe. The foundations of Europe as it is known today were set. The major nation-states that were to dominate in Western Europe for the rest of the millennium -- England, France Germany and Russia -- were founded during the High Middle Ages. WebChildren experienced literature in the Middle Ages in two ways: orally and in written form. The oral tradition was probably way more extensive and was accessible to every child, no matter their social status. Not every child could read, but most children could listen to stories, songs, and rhymes told to them by parents and nurses. The Dragon and the Raven: Or the Days of King Alfred. how many boiling water reactors are in the usWebThe Dark Ages, formerly a designation for the entire period of the Middle Ages, and later for the period c.450–750, is now usually known as the Early Middle Ages. The term Dark Ages may be more a judgment on the lack of sources for evaluating the period than on the significance of events that transpired.
